Objectives of the Course

Sudents in sectors, obligations in the context of entrepreneurial concepts and principles to teach business administration.

Course Content

Definition of Enterprise and Entrepreneurship, and the Importance of Entrepreneurship in the History of Economic Thought, International Entrepreneurship Criteria, Social Values and the Entrepreneurial Mindset, entrepreneur and Entrepreneur Personality Traits Personality Acquiring Entrepreneurial Thought Process Development and Entrepreneurship, Entrepreneurship, and Policy Options, World and Entrepreneurship in Turkey Turkey Entrepreneurship Areas, l Entrepreneurship Opportunities in Turkey, Turkey, Entrepreneurship Problems, infrastructure preparations for the Development of Entrepreneurship in Turkey, Success stories in Industry , Industral experience

Learning Outcomes
1.To be able to explain the concepts ofenterprise and entrepreneurship
2.To be able to examine the role of entrepreneurship in economic development
3.To be able ro explain the basic functions of Entrepreneurship
4.To be able to recognize the advantages and disadvantages of entrepreneurship
5.To be able to classify types of Entrepreneurship
6.To be able to disscuss teh policies and t possibilities of entrepreneurship
7.To be able to analyse areas of entrepreneurship
8.To be able to disscuss the key point in enterpreneurs
9.To be able to evaluatethe economic aspectsof entrepreneurial activities
10.To be able to compare the level of entrepreneurship in Turkey and other countries
